The durable and bold Aries 4" Big Step nerf bars have extra-wide, non-slip step pads that allow you to enter and exit your vehicle's cabin with confidence. A round profile and custom bends are combined with a rugged, textured finish to create an ideal match for off-road vehicles. The bars are constructed of hardened T6 aluminum alloy that is strong and corrosion resistant.
The nerf bars install quickly and easily with custom-fit mounting brackets. The carbon steel brackets mount to pre-existing holes in your vehicle's frame - no drilling required. Each side bar fits the contours of your specific vehicle to ease installation and improve functionality. The top-mounted step pads are also customized to match the layout of your truck cabin's doors.

Speaker 1: Today on our 2015 Ram 1500 we're going to be test fitting the four inch Aries Nerf Bars, Part Number AAAL235041.These nice round bars will help you get in easily, and quickly. The extra wide, non-slick step pads will help you get in when it's wet, and in other snowy and icy conditions. Since your trucks a crew cab, you'll get the same thing in the back for your friends and family.The pads feature a polypropylene construction, which will make it crack and UV resistant. Unlike other round bars, this one features a textured black finish giving it a rugged exterior. Unlike the glossy and chrome finishes this will hide scratches and chips. The bars feature welded end caps, which keeps out moisture to prevent rust and corrosion.
The four inch tubular bars have 23 and a half inch step pads that are four inches wide. The pads come pre-installed on the bars, the bars come in a quantity of two and all the hardware you need to install it without drilling is included.We're gonna start with our front bracket on the driver's side. So, we'll need to get down underneath and begin the installation. We need to begin removing the tape covering the holes in these two locations. Then take your M8 bracket, slide on your plastic retainer and push it into the frame there in the front hole.
You'll then take your M12 bracket and slide its plastic retainer on, and put it in the hole to the rear of the M8. Then grab the appropriate bracket for the driver's front, it'll be labeled on the bracket. Slide it over your bolts, slide on your M8 washer, M8 lock washer and hand tighten your M8 nut. You'll do the same for the M12 bracket. Then you'll take your M10 bolt, slide on your lock washer, your washer then line up the nut on your M12 bracket with the middle hole that's between your M8 and M12, and thread in that bolt.
We'll leave it loose for now, as we're gonna need to make some adjustments later. So we'll install the rear bracket.Now, here at the back panel on the driver's side we're gonna install our rear bracket. Here at the back panel you'll see the tape above the two open holes. We need to remove that tape and grab your M12 bracket, slide on the plastic retainer, and put it into place. You'll then slide your bracket into place.
Here we've got our M10 lock washer and washer. You'll again need to line up the M10 nut on the bracket, and thread in your bolt. Then take your M12 washer, M12 lock washer and M12 nut and thread it on. Again, leave it hand tight as we're gonna need to adjust the height after we get the bar into place.Now, we'll take our drivers side bar, set it up to the brackets and start the bolts. Now take your black M8 bolt, lock washer and washer and thread into your nerf bar. Do the same on both holes, then you'll repeat this same process on the rear bracket. Now, you'll adjust your bracket to make it even and then tighten down the bolts using a 16 millimeter socket. You'll then tighten down your upper bolt using an 18 millimeter socket. Now we'll adjust the front and tighten it down. Now that it's adjusted, tighten the back barge nut with your 18 millimeter socket. The lower bolt here with your 16 millimeter socket. Then your small front 13 millimeter bolt.You'll now want to adjust the height of your bars. I did this by using my pinky between the bar and the pinch weld. So we'll line it up on both sides, then snug your bolts down. Adjust for a pinky's length again here in the back, and tighten your bolts down.That completes our test fit of the Aries Big Step Nerf Bars on our 2015 Ram 1500.
